diff: Integrate libdiff from OpenBSD GoT. This adds support for two new diff algorithms, Myers diff and Patience diff. These algorithms perform a different form of search compared to the classic Stone algorithm and support escapes when worst case scenarios are encountered. Add the -A flag to allow selection of the algorithm, but default to using the new Myers diff implementation. The libdiff implementation currently only supports a subset of input and output options supported by diff. When these options are used, but the algorithm is not selected, automatically fallback to the classic Stone algorithm until support for these modes can be added. Import diff from OpenBSD and remove GNU diff Some of the modifications from the previous summer of code has been integrated Modification for compatibility with GNU diff output has been added Main difference with OpenBSD: Implement multiple GNU diff options: * --ignore-file-name-case * --no-ignore-file-name-case * --normal * --tabsize * --strip-trailing-cr Make diff -p compatible with GNU diff Implement diff -l Make diff -r compatible with GNU diff Capsicumize diffing 2 regular files Add a simple test suite Approved by: AsiaBSDcon devsummit Obtained from: OpenBSD, GSoC Relnotes: yes
